    6. Grammar/Mechanics Checkup 9: Semicolons and Colons

    You will use commas and periods most frequently in your business sentences. However, a good writer should know how to use colons and semicolons as well. These two punctuation marks might look similar, but they serve different purposes.

    Determine what punctuation rule is illustrated by the following sentence.

    At our company retreat, I met employees from Tempe, Arizona; Denver, Colorado; and Honolulu, Hawaii.

    Use a semicolon to separate items in a series when one or more of the items contain internal commas.
